just thought i would share my super cheap, fully functional, electrical setup.
i started with 2 super bright cree 2000 lumen lights, an old gps enabled phone, mini rechargeable speakers, signal/brake/running lights with built in horn, and a solar charger, also with an internal storage battery.
i put the 14500/18650 charge adapter inside the bag to reduce clutter.
all of it is usb enabled, so i can solar charge or quick charge all of them with any usb plug.
total cost... under $40. gps, music, wicked speedometer app and all.
total weight... about 1 pound.
all of it is setup so i can remove it quickly if i want wanted too, wiring harness and all.
